comments: display comment previews while submitting Instead of just saying 'Submitting' and not showing any progress to the user until the comment has been accepted by the server, show a preview of the comment above the comment box in a way which is makes it obvious to the user the comment is being submitted. Apart from that, also clear the comment box so that a repeated clicking the submit button doesn't result in a duplicate comment. The preview doesn't highlight URLs or support @mentions or *bold*, which is a good enough approximation in this case. When/if we (re-)add the rST/Markdown support, we will need a client-side parser for the syntax we choose. When the submission fails, display a message and offer the user to retry or cancel the submission.

#!/sbin/runscript
########################################
#### THIS IS AN GENTOO INIT.D SCRIPT####
########################################

APP_NAME="kallithea"
APP_HOMEDIR="username/python_workspace"
APP_PATH="/home/$APP_HOMEDIR/$APP_NAME"

CONF_NAME="production.ini"

PID_PATH="$APP_PATH/$APP_NAME.pid"
LOG_PATH="$APP_PATH/$APP_NAME.log"

PYTHON_PATH="/home/$APP_HOMEDIR/v-env"

RUN_AS="username"

DAEMON="$PYTHON_PATH/bin/gearbox"

DAEMON_OPTS="serve --daemon \
--user=$RUN_AS \
--group=$RUN_AS \
--pid-file=$PID_PATH \
--log-file=$LOG_PATH -c $APP_PATH/$CONF_NAME"

#extra options
opts="${opts} restartdelay"

depend() {
    need nginx
}

start() {
    ebegin "Starting $APP_NAME"
    start-stop-daemon -d $APP_PATH -e PYTHON_EGG_CACHE="/tmp" \
        --start --quiet \
        --pidfile $PID_PATH \
        --user $RUN_AS \
        --exec $DAEMON -- $DAEMON_OPTS
    eend $?
}

stop() {
    ebegin "Stopping $APP_NAME"
    start-stop-daemon -d $APP_PATH \
        --stop --quiet \
        --pidfile $PID_PATH || echo "$APP_NAME - Not running!"
    if [ -f $PID_PATH ]; then
        rm $PID_PATH
    fi
    eend $?
}

restartdelay() {
    #stop()
    echo "sleep3"
    sleep 3

    #start()
}
